The Navy’s website also provides real-world examples, revealing the average monthly salary for enlisted sailors is between $1,566 and $2,614.20, whereas the average monthly salary for officers is between $2,972.40 and $7,447.10. Military base pay, which is reflected in these pay tables, is based only on the member’s pay grade and time in service. Enlisted men and women are moved more frequently. Why is there such a significant gap between enlisted and officer pay? Servicemember’s base pay does not vary based on their career field, MOS, or rating. Navy pay is determined primarily by your rate/rank and years of service, and adjusts based on whether you’re Enlisted or an Officer, Active Duty (full time) or a Reservist (part time). Noncommissioned officers (NCOs) are high-ranking enlisted service members who have been given officer-like authority by their superiors. Such doesn't have to be said. Warrant officers are promoted from the enlisted ranks for technical expertise and rank between the highest enlisted and lowest commissioned officers. For instance, the Army has two ranks at an E-4, but only one of them is an NCO, and the Air Force’s lowest-rank for an NCO is an E-5.
